Description

  • Color: Treebark Camo
  • Resolution: 32MP
  • Trigger Speed: 0.15 Second
  • Battery Size: AA
  • Stamp: Date / Moon Phase / Temp / Time
  • Battery Count: 6
  • Video Resolution: 4K
  • Audio: Yes
  • Battery Life: Up to 12 Months
119987C Core Trail Camera Treebark Camo 1.50" Color LCD Display 32MP Resolution 512 GB Memory
The CORE DS-4K offers dual sensors for high quality images day and night and checks all the boxes successful hunters want the most: The highest picture resolution with dual sensors for the best image quality at day and night, plus optimized battery life for maximum image captures and more time in the field without checking batteries.This product also features Display of 1.50" Color LCD, Memory of 512 GB, Picture or Video of Photo / Video, and GPS Enabled of Yes.

I own three of this model and one with the single sensor. They're my go-to night video cameras and I've ordered several competitors that are long on promises and short on delivery. The video resolution really is 4K at 18p or 20p. I think this changed over time because my first unit is only 18p and the later ones are 20p. Some of the competitors brag about higher resolutions but they're fake or if it is 4K then they are 10p which is more like stop-motion animation. I can't use those in my night-time wildlife videos. 20p translated to 24p has noticeable jerkiness but that seems to be acceptable nowadays. Audio is 48kHz stereo and also stands well above the cheaper knock-offs. Some of the units have an annoying periodic hum in the background but at lest it is lower level. I've tried filtering it out but it's in a useful portion of the spectrum. Wildlife video viewers really appreciate good audio. These cameras have a fairly narrow field of view compared to others. You need to know where you want these pointed. I'm capturing wildlife in general and aim at well-traveled paths like a hole under the fence and a fence gate. The field of view is good for small animals (skunks, foxes, even mice/rats) but I only get partial body views of deer, cougar, or bears. If you need a wider field of view, you might want to consider something else. The wider field of view cameras don't trigger on the smaller animals. Knowing exactly where you are pointed and the actual field of view is a chore. The little built-in screen is difficult to see and while you're looking at it, you block the camera view. I've resigned myself to placing it best I can, triggering it to capture some video, taking the SD card out, and viewing it in on a computer. Repeat a few times to get it right. If you're going to keep the camera in one place, this chore is performed few times. One of my units drops the battery tray if it gets jarred. I can force it closed now with a 1/4 x 20 screw and washer on the bottom screw mount but I lost a few weeks of footage before discovering this. The whole plastic battery tray design and ejection system needs a little tweaking, IMO. I like the relatively quick re-trigger times. I find 1 sec to be the quickest useful setting. Lower re-trigger times at night seem fail to capture properly. It seems that the no-glow lights remain on long enough that on the re-trigger the camera thinks it is daytime so it does not turn the lights back on and the video is dark. So 1 sec re-trigger is my reliable setting and it's pretty good. Less than that may be good for daytime only. AA lithium ion batteries are my only choice and they last for several weeks with 6-8 captures every night. I use the Dynamic capture time and it works well to stay on for the action. I appreciate that the firmware keeps the settings and clock while I swap out batteries. Not sure for how long, but certainly for several minutes. The camera lenses are well shielded from the rain. On other cameras I've had to create my own rain shield but these stay clear for most (not all) situations and if not, they dry out themselves without extra maintenance. I'll keep looking for better 4K options but everything else disappoints. Look forward to a Bushnell update!

This worked nice for about a month, and then problems started. It stopped taking color pictures at all, and only black and white, day or night. I tried all different settings, tried various default settings as well as different camera locations, still only black and white. Now after quite a few months of use it has started forgetting the internal settings, and when you come back a week later to check your pictures, they are all stamped as 11:15 time, and the date of 12-22-2293. Sometimes I may have over 100 pictures taken over the course of a week, and all are stamped the same date in the future. This is an expensive camera, so very disappointed in being stuck with this one.

Bought the camera mostly for taking videos of local critters. Sadly you still can't have more than 15sec videos with full illumination at night, something that even the cheapest China cams can do. At least you can turn down the LEDs to get longer video recording and while nighttime videos are pretty good, the lens on the daytime camera seems to have an issue as on one side of the frame the video is soft while the other side is as sharp as you would expect. Seems to be an alignment issue between the elements of the lens.

Using this to monitor remote property and am quite pleased with initial setup tests. I need to be able identifying features-vehicle name, license plate, etc.-of vehicles entering and leaving property. The dual sensors work much better than my single sensor other camera which only gives me a “no glow flash” reflection off reflective license plates. Pictures are sharper too.

Needs a wide angle lens. The motion sensor is terrible, doesn't start recording until an animal is nearly past the camera, or will record the tiniest bird, there is no sweet spot on the sensor settings. The image quality in 4k is actually quite bad, the frame rate is terrible. At night, if it decides to record at all, will save 1 second videos when the settings are for 1 minute videos. I have messed with all of the settings time and time again, either I have a defective unit or this is just not a very good trail camera. I'll be returning it.
